
Acelimb P Tablet
Marketer
Limbson Pharmaceuticals LLP
Salt Composition
Aceclofenac (100mg) + Paracetamol (325mg)
Overview Acelimb P Tablet
Paralgin-P tablets offer analgesic relief. This medication targets pain and inflammation associated with conditions such as r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and osteoarthritis. It also provides relief from muscular aches, back pain, dental pain, and ear, nose, and throat discomfort. Paralgin-P tablets can be administered with or without food, consistently as prescribed by your physician. Dosage adjustments, including frequency, may be made based on your individual pain response and medical history. Strictly adhere to your doctor's recommended dosage and duration; exceeding these guidelines is discouraged. Commonly reported side effects include nausea, vomiting, abdominal discomfort, appetite suppression, indigestion, and diarrhea. Persistent or bothersome side effects warrant immediate medical consultation. Your doctor can explore alternative treatments or dosage modifications to mitigate these effects. Paralgin-P tablets may not be appropriate for all patients. Individuals with pre-existing cardiac, renal, hepatic issues, or peptic ulcers should inform their physician prior to commencing treatment. Comprehensive disclosure of all current medications is crucial for ensuring safe usage. Expectant and nursing mothers must seek medical counsel before using Paralgin-P tablets.

Common Side effects of Acelimb P Tablet:
- Nausea
- Vomiting
- Stomach pain/epigastric pain
- Loss of appetite
- Heartburn
- Diarrhea
How to use Acelimb P Tablet:
Follow your doctor's instructions precisely regarding dosage and treatment length for Acelimb P Tablet. Ingest the t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or breaking it. While Acelimb P Tablet can be taken with or without food, consistency in timing is recommended.
How Acelimb P Tablet works:
Acelimb P Tablet combines aceclofenac and paracetamol to alleviate pain, fever, and inflammation. Its dual action targets inflammatory chemical messengers, reducing symptoms like redness and swelling.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Consuming alcohol alongside Acelimb P Tablet is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Using Acelimb P Tablet during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to the unborn child.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any risks before pr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Data on Acelimb P Tablet use while breastfeeding is l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ician.
DrivingUNSAFE
Acelimb P Tablet may c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ness, potentially impairing alertness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Acelimb P Tablet, as dosage modification may be necessary. Severe kidney disease contraindicates the use of Acelimb P Tablet; physician consultation is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should exercise caution when using Acelimb P Tablets,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ult your physician. Acelimb P Tablets are contraindicated for individuals with severe or active liver disease.
What if you forget to take Acelimb P Tablet :
Should you forget a dose of Acelimb P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
